    Collapse Research 
    Collapse research activities and funding
    R01DK130517     (MARGOLIS, KARA GROSS)Aug 15, 2021 - Jul 31, 2025
    NIH
    A Prospective Study Examining the Role of Gestational SSRI Exposure in the Development of Functional Gastrointestinal Disorders
    Role: Co-Principal Investigator

    P01AI152999     (ARIAS, CESAR AUGUSTO ;SAVIDGE, TOR ;SHELBURNE, SAMUEL A)Aug 1, 2020 - Jul 31, 2025
    NIH
    Dynamics of Colonization and Infection by Multidrug-resistant Pathogens in Immunocompromised and Critically Ill Patients (DYNAMITE)
    Role: Co-Principal Investigator

    U01AI124290     (SAVIDGE, TOR)Aug 20, 2016 - Jul 31, 2021
    NIH
    Decoding Antibiotic-induced Susceptibility to Clostridium difficile Infection
    Role: Principal Investigator

    R21DK096323     (SAVIDGE, TOR)Sep 15, 2014 - Aug 31, 2016
    NIH
    Metabolome-Based Biomarkers and Neutraceuticals in Clostridium Difficile Infection
    Role: Principal Investigator

    R01AI100914     (SAVIDGE, TOR)Jun 1, 2012 - May 31, 2018
    NIH
    Allosteric therapy of the Clostridium difficile toxins
    Role: Principal Investigator

    R21DK078032     (SAVIDGE, TOR)Jun 1, 2009 - May 31, 2012
    NIH
    S-nitrosoglutathione regulation of intestinal barrier function in Crohn's disease
    Role: Principal Investigator
